Taking Switches on Compressions: The Art of Reliable CPR

When it comes to providing CPR, taking turns on compressions is vital for maintaining top quality upper body compressions. It assists prevent exhaustion amongst rescuers and guarantees that the casualty receives consistent and efficient compressions. The suggested rate for breast compressions is between 100 to 120 per minute, with a deepness of a minimum of 2 inches for adults. Rescuers should switch over every 2 mins or earlier if they really feel fatigued.

Understanding Standard vs Advanced Life Support

Before diving into the specifics of CPR methods, it's crucial to separate in between fundamental and innovative life support (BLS vs ALS).

Basic Life Assistance (BLS)

BLS generally involves non-invasive procedures executed by laymans or very first responders learnt mouth-to-mouth resuscitation. It concentrates on:

    Checking Responsiveness: Evaluating whether the person is conscious. Identifying No Breathing: Observing if the individual is not taking a breath or taking a breath abnormally. Administering Chest Compressions: Doing top notch breast compressions and rescue breaths if trained.

Advanced Life Support (ALS)

ALS incorporates more advanced medical interventions normally performed by medical care specialists, such as paramedics or medical professionals. It consists of:

    Use of advanced air passage management techniques Administration of medications Monitoring important signs

Both BLS and ALS are essential parts of emergency action systems yet serve various roles within individual care.

Identifying No Breathing

Identifying no breathing is critical in verifying heart attack. After inspecting responsiveness:

    Look for breast rise. Listen for breath sounds. Feel for air against your cheek.

If there's no normal breath within 10 seconds, call for help promptly and start chest compressions.

The Technicians Behind Taking Switches On Compressions

Taking turns on compressions involves organized sychronisation among rescuers:

Timing Your Switch: Purpose to switch over every two mins or after 5 cycles of 30 compressions and 2 breaths. Communicate Clearly: Usage expressions like "Change!" so everyone knows when to change without missing a beat. Stay Reliable: Keep transitions smooth-- don't allow hands leave the breast during switches.

This technique avoids fatigue and maintains top quality compression criteria needed for efficient resuscitation efforts.

Lower Compression Depth: Why It Matters

Maintaining proper compression depth is vital in guaranteeing blood circulation throughout heart attack:

Adult Deepness: At least 2 inches (5 cm) Child Depth: Concerning 1/3 the depth of their chest Infant Deepness: About 1 1/2 inches (4 centimeters)

Lower compression midsts stop working to generate appropriate blood circulation-- ensuring correct depth directly correlates with survival rates.
